如何使用AbeimAPI进行免费的域名备案查询?

完整指南

随着互联网的不断发展,域名备案变得越来越重要。在中国,所有网站都需要进行备案,以确保其合规合法。AbeimAPI提供了一种便捷的方法来进行域名备案查询。本文将为您详细介绍如何使用AbeimAPI进行免费的域名备案查询,从基础概念到高级应用一应俱全。

一、基础概念

备案是指在从事互联网信息服务之前,网站所有者必须向当地通信管理局提交相关信息,以取得合法的运营资格。在中国,域名备案是法律规定的一项义务,有助于维护互联网的安全与稳定。

二、AbeimAPI简介

AbeimAPI是一个提供多种网络服务的API平台,其中包括域名备案查询服务。该API允许用户通过简单的接口调用,迅速获取目标域名的备案信息。其易用性及快速的响应时间,使其成为开发者及企业的理想选择。

三、使用AbeimAPI进行域名备案查询的步骤

1. 注册AbeimAPI账户

要使用AbeimAPI,您首先需要访问其官方网站并注册一个账户。注册过程中,您需要填写有效的电子邮件地址及密码,完成验证后即可登录。

2. 获取API密钥

注册成功后,您将能够在账户设置中找到您的API密钥。该密钥是您调用API时的身份凭证,请妥善保管,确保其安全。

3. 查阅API文档

在进行域名备案查询前,强烈建议您查阅AbeimAPI的官方文档,以了解可用的接口、请求参数及返回数据格式。文档中包含了详细的示例代码,方便您快速上手。

四、进行备案查询

1. 发起请求

使用您获取的API密钥,您可以通过HTTP请求向AbeimAPI的备案查询接口发送请求。以下是一个简单的示例:

        GET https://api.abeim.com/record?domain=yourdomain.com&apikey=your_api_key
    

2. 解析返回数据

成功发起请求后,AbeimAPI会返回一段JSON格式的数据,其中包含了该域名的备案信息。您可以使用编程语言自带的JSON解析库来提取所需的数据。

3. 使用备案信息

获得备案信息后,您可以根据需要,将其用于站点的合规性验证、监控备案状态或生成报表等功能。

五、高级应用

1. 批量查询

对于拥有大量域名的企业来说,批量查询备案信息是一项必不可少的功能。您可以编写脚本,循环调用AbeimAPI的备案查询接口,以一次性获取多个域名的备案情况。

2. 集成至监控系统

将AbeimAPI集成到您的网站监控系统中,可以实时监控域名的备案状态。如果某个域名的备案信息发生变化,系统可以自动发送提醒,确保网站的合规运营。

3. 数据分析与报告生成

结合查询到的备案数据,您可以使用数据分析工具对域名备案信息进行分析,从而导出相应的报告。这对于企业的合规审计和风险控制具有重要意义。

六、常见问题解答

1. 什么是域名备案?

域名备案是指在中国,网站运营者向政府主管部门提交网站信息,以便进行合法注册与管理。未备案的网站会面临被关闭的风险。

2. AbeimAPI是否收费?

AbeimAPI提供免费的域名备案查询服务,但也有计费的高级服务。如果需要更多数据的深度查询,可能需要付费。

3. 如何提高请求效率?

针对批量查询的需求,建议实现数据缓存机制,避免重复请求;同时,可以合理分配请求间隔,以降低被封禁的风险。

4. 如果查询不到备案信息怎么办?

如果您通过AbeimAPI查询不到某个域名的备案信息,可能是该域名未备案,或者信息尚未更新。建议定期检查或直接咨询相关管理部门。

七、总结

通过上述指南,您应该对如何使用AbeimAPI进行免费的域名备案查询有了全面的了解。从基础的API调用到高级的应用场景,AbeimAPI为网站备案提供了极大的便利。无论您是开发者、企业还是个人站长,都能从中受益。务必遵循当地法律法规,确保网站的合规性运行。